This episode discusses the challenges faced by adult social care in Gloucestershire County Council (GCC), including increasing demand, complex needs, and pressure on health and social care services.
In response to these challenges, the team at GCC have developed a new strategy called the Target Operating Model (TOM). You will hear Jo Sutherland, the principal social worker, Merryn Tate, assistant director and strategic lead for Short Term Services and Jen Simms - integrated social care manager talk about their vision. They also talk about what excites them about the TOM.
